Patricia Josephine Hawks was born December 31, 1937, in Creston, Iowa, the daughter of William Leo Hawks and Loretta Teresa Treanor Hawks. She graduated from Creston High School with the Class of 1955 and attended Ottumwa Heights College receiving a degree in Education. She moved to Williamsburg and was employed as a 4th grade teacher. She and Thomas Edward McDonough were united in marriage on July 2, 1960, in Creston. She later worked as a secretary for Home Oil and Tire, and then with the Williamsburg Community School District.

Pat’s priorities in life were faith, family and friends. Over the years, she and Tom enjoyed many trips with their three sons. Pat was a member of the St. Mary Catholic Church in Williamsburg, the Altar and Rosary Society, and the Ladies Auxiliary of VFW Post 8797.

Pat is survived by her sons, Mark of Janesville, WI, Matthew (Julie) of Underwood, Iowa, and John of Williamsburg; seven grandchildren, Luke (Chelsea) McDonough of Lincoln, NE, Cole McDonough of Omaha, Drew McDonough of Davenport, Brock McDonough of Underwood, Breana McDonough Seeger (Austin) of Broadhead, WI, Allison McDonough (Dom Sampson) of Nashville, TN, and Jack McDonough of Brainerd, MN; a great grandchild Maeve Seeger and one on the way. Also surviving are her sisters in law, Lourdell Hawks and Charlene Hawks, along with many nieces, nephews, grand and great-grand nieces and nephews.

She was preceded in death by her parents, her husband Tom, and her siblings, Teresa Hawks, Paul Hawks, Gene Hawks, Vincent Hawks, Ed Hawks, and Loretta Hawks Torpy, a nephew Stephen Hawks and a grand-nephew Mason Lefeber.
